Insurance Commissioner residency, Trump endorses Mazzei again, Health Care Authority probe and more

from This Week in Oklahoma Politics · host KOSU

This Week in Oklahoma Politics, KOSU's Michael Cross talks with Civic Leader Andy Moore and Legislative Advisor Jennifer Monies about a report finding Oklahoma Insurance Commission candidate Marty Quinn might be living in Arkansas, President Trump releasing a video to reiterate his support of Mike Mazzei for governor against Attorney General Gentner Drummond in the August 25th runoff election and state election officials forced to defend the voting system after accusations from Trump.The trio also discusses Attorney General Gentner Drummond launching an investigation of the state's Medicaid agency over potential fraud and the state releasing a plan to reduce the wait-time for inmates to get mental health treatment.
